![]() |
[JS] רעיון בקשר לגניבת קוד JS.
ככה:
יש 2 קבצי JS - מס' 1, ומס' 2. בקובץ מס' 1 יהיה כל הקוד כמו שצריך. בקובץ מס' 2 יהיה ייבוא של תוכן קובץ מס' 1 (בתגית script רגילה) אבל הוא יהיה ללא ירידת שורות (הדבר היחידי שאני לא יודע איך לעשות), משמע - כל פעם שבקובץ א' תהיה ירידת שורה, בקובץ א' יהיה רק רווח (דבר שלא ימנע מהקובץ להמשיך להיות תקין). קובץ ה JS שייובא בדף ה HTML (לדוג') יהיה קובץ מס' 2. אולי חלקכם שואלים מה יוצא כאן? מה שיוצא כאן הוא של 'גנב' יהיה קשה לקרוא את הקוד. למה צריך את קובץ מס' 1 בכלל?! צריך את קובץ מס' 1 כדי שיהיה אפשר לכתוב את הקוד בנוחות. יואב. |
לא הבנתי מה הפואנטה של האשכול הזה...
|
שאני לא יודע איך ליישם את זה :P (בקטע של ההפיכת ירידות שורה לרווחים..)
|
אתה מנסה לעשות שכשיצפו בקוד מקור שלך אז במקום שיראו ירידות שורה שעשית, יראו רק רווחים?
|
ציטוט:
|
חח אצלי תמיד שאני כותב בעורך אחר מnotepad, כגון ++notepad או HTMLKit, ואני יורד שם שורות כרגיל, אחרי זה אני מעלה את זה לשרת, עושה לפעמים "הצג קוד מקור" ואז זה מראה לי הכל ביחד, רק עם רווחים, בלי ירידת שורה... בלי שום קודים מיוחדים
|
אז יש לך פתרון קצת יותר הגיוני, מה שנקרא Obfuscator - "משבש קוד" (בתרגום חופשי). זה מקדד את הקוד
|
ציטוט:
|
ציטוט:
תריץ בגוגל Javascript code obfuscator , אני בטוח שיש כמה כאלה. יש גם לשפות סקריפטינג אחרות כמו ASP, PHP וכו' |
למה צריך לקודד PHP ו ASP אם אי אפשר לראות אותן בקוד מקור...?
|
כל הזמנים הם GMT +2. הזמן כעת הוא 10:33. |
מופעל באמצעות VBulletin גרסה 3.8.6
כל הזכויות שמורות ©
כל הזכויות שמורות לסולל יבוא ורשתות (1997) בע"מ